Output 67aab8b229f6e378a65c136a28197b16403721dcf81ce99be69e829e09f91c23:2

value
1102215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90a2b03b96d681f0d29a88ea8bbfc438d909bfa OP_EQUAL
address
MSEAEUVqLuiA7D1wFJEU4bBKPBms8JKShE
transaction
67aab8b229f6e378a65c136a28197b16403721dcf81ce99be69e829e09f91c23
spent
true